LUX Center for the Arts Awards Scholarships to 49 Lincoln Students through Art Scholar Program
The LUX Center for the Arts honored 49 students from 23 Lincoln Title 1 schools with scholarships at its Ninth Annual Art Scholar Ceremony, held on Sunday, January 19, 2025, at O’Donnell Auditorium at Nebraska Wesleyan University. The event celebrated the recipients of $500 scholarships through the LUX Art Scholar Program, which provides young artists with opportunities to expand their creativity and further their artistic education.
Family members, friends, and community supporters gathered to watch the students receive their awards from representatives of the Pearle Francis Finigan Foundation and the Pace Woods Foundation, along with LUX Executive Director, Joe Shaw.
Each student was presented with an award certificate, a LUX Art Scholar t-shirt, and a bag filled with art supplies. The scholarships will enable the recipients to attend a variety of summer camps, classes, and workshops throughout the year, offering them invaluable opportunities to develop their skills and pursue their passion for the arts.
The scholarship recipients were selected by their school’s art instructors based on their artistic potential and the transformative impact the scholarship could have on their lives. "This program is one area where we are succeeding in providing art education to a diverse group of children, and we’ve been doing it every year since 2017," said Joe Shaw, LUX Executive Director. "We started this program with 12 scholarships, and thanks to the generosity of the Pearle Francis Finigan Foundation and the Pace Woods Foundation, we’ve been able to increase the number of scholarships each year. This year, we awarded 49 scholarships."
The LUX Art Scholar Program continues to play a key role in supporting the LUX Center for the Arts' mission to nurture the next generation of artists and creative leaders in the community.
